Abstract

The utility model discloses a telescopic structure of an electronic product fixing device, which comprises a first protection shell and a movable seat; the first protection shell is used for being matched with one end of the electronic product, and the movable seat is movably arranged on the first protection shell and comprises a second protection shell which is used for being matched with the other end of the electronic product; an elastic element is arranged between the movable seat and the first protection shell and is used for providing an elastic force for promoting the second protection shell to move towards the direction close to the first protection shell. According to the utility model, the movable seat is movably arranged on the first protection shell, and the elastic element is arranged between the movable seat and the first protection shell, so that the movable seat can move relative to the first protection shell under the action of external force, and the movable seat can be suitable for electronic products with different lengths; moreover, the structure is simple, the assembly is convenient and fast, and the manufacturing cost can be effectively controlled.

Description

Telescopic structure of electronic product fixing device
Technical Field
The utility model relates to the field of electronic product fixing devices, in particular to a telescopic structure of an electronic product fixing device.
Background
The conventional electronic product fixing device generally comprises a plastic sleeve, so that the plastic sleeve is sleeved on electronic products such as a mobile phone or a tablet personal computer. The electronic product fixing device is also commonly applied to the support frame to fix the electronic product through the plastic sleeve of the support frame, so that the electronic product can be conveniently watched by a user without holding the electronic product by means of the support frame. However, the plastic sleeve is often integrally formed, so that the plastic sleeve is only suitable for electronic products with the same length, but cannot be suitable for electronic products with different lengths, and therefore, the plastic sleeve has a narrow application range and can not meet market demands.
Disclosure of Invention
In order to overcome the defects of the prior art, the utility model aims to provide a telescopic structure of an electronic product fixing device, which is applicable to electronic products with different lengths, so that the application range of the telescopic structure can be enlarged.
The utility model adopts the following technical scheme:
a telescopic structure of an electronic product fixing device comprises a first protection shell and a movable seat; the first protection shell is used for being matched with one end of the electronic product, and the movable seat is movably arranged on the first protection shell and comprises a second protection shell which is used for being matched with the other end of the electronic product; an elastic element is arranged between the movable seat and the first protection shell and is used for providing an elastic force for promoting the second protection shell to move towards the direction close to the first protection shell.
The movable seat also comprises a movable part arranged on the second protection shell, the first protection shell is provided with a movable cavity, and the movable part is movably inserted in the movable cavity.
One end of the elastic element is propped against the movable part, and the other end is propped against the first protection shell.
One end of the movable part, which is far away from the second protection shell, is formed into a pressure-bearing end; the elastic element is positioned in the movable cavity, one end of the elastic element is propped against the pressure-bearing end of the movable part, and the other end of the elastic element is propped against the cavity wall of the movable cavity.
The movable seat also comprises two movable parts arranged on the second protection shell, the first protection shell is provided with two movable cavities corresponding to the two movable cavities one by one respectively, the movable parts are movably inserted in the corresponding movable cavities, and the telescopic structure of the electronic product fixing device comprises two elastic elements corresponding to the two movable cavities one by one respectively; the elastic element is positioned in the corresponding movable cavity and is abutted between the cavity wall of the corresponding movable cavity and the pressure-bearing end of the movable part.
The movable part is a bolt which is connected to the second protective shell in a threaded manner.
The end head part of the bolt is formed into the pressure-bearing end, one end of the movable cavity, which is close to the second protection shell, is provided with an opening for a screw rod of the bolt to pass through, and the diameter of the end head part of the bolt is larger than that of the opening.
The elastic element is a spring.
The electronic product is a mobile phone or a tablet personal computer.
The first protection shell and the second protection shell are both used for being buckled and matched with the electronic product.
Compared with the prior art, the utility model has the beneficial effects that:
the telescopic structure of the electronic product fixing device provided by the utility model has the advantages that the movable seat is movably arranged on the first protection shell, and the elastic element is arranged between the movable seat and the first protection shell, so that the movable seat can move relative to the first protection shell under the action of external force, and the distance between the second protection shell and the first protection shell of the movable seat can be adjusted, so that the telescopic structure can be suitable for electronic products with different lengths; moreover, the structure is simple, the assembly is convenient and fast, and the manufacturing cost can be effectively controlled.

Detailed Description
The present utility model will be further described with reference to the accompanying drawings and detailed description, wherein it is to be understood that, on the premise of no conflict, the following embodiments or technical features may be arbitrarily combined to form new embodiments.
As shown in fig. 1 to 4, a telescopic structure of an electronic product fixing device includes a first protective housing 100 and a movable base 200; the first protection casing 100 is configured to cooperate with one end of the electronic product, and the movable seat 200 is movably mounted on the first protection casing 100 and includes a second protection casing 210 configured to cooperate with the other end of the electronic product; an elastic element 300 is disposed between the movable seat 200 and the first protection housing 100, and the elastic element 300 is used for providing an elastic force for urging the second protection housing 210 to move toward the direction approaching the first protection housing 100.
When the electronic product fixing device is used, the first protection shell 100 can be matched with one end of an electronic product, the movable seat 200 is pushed away from the first protection shell 100, the second protection shell 210 of the movable seat 200 is matched with the other end of the electronic product, and the second protection shell 210 can be tensioned towards the first protection shell 100 through the elastic element 300, so that the loosening phenomenon can be avoided.
The movable seat 200 further includes a movable portion 220 disposed on the second protection housing 210, the first protection housing 100 is provided with a movable cavity 110, and the movable portion 220 is movably inserted into the movable cavity 110, so that the movable seat 200 can move along the movable cavity 110, so as to realize that the movable seat 200 is movably mounted on the first protection housing 100. Of course, in addition to this, in order to realize that the movable seat 200 is movably mounted on the first protection housing 100, other structures may be adopted, for example, a support rod may be further disposed on the first protection housing 100, a sleeve sleeved on the support rod is disposed on the movable seat 200, and the movable seat 200 may be also movably mounted on the first protection housing 100, but by adopting the combination of the movable portion 220 and the movable cavity 110, the movable seat 200 may be movably mounted on the first protection housing 100, and the installation is convenient, and the installation of the elastic element 300 is convenient.
One end of the elastic element 300 abuts against the movable portion 220, and the other end abuts against the first protection housing 100. Specifically, an end of the movable portion 220 away from the second protection housing 210 is formed as a bearing end 221; the elastic element 300 is located in the movable cavity 110, and one end of the elastic element 300 abuts against the bearing end 221 of the movable portion 220, and the other end abuts against the cavity wall of the movable cavity 110.
The movable seat 200 further comprises two movable portions 220 disposed on the second protection housing 210, the first protection housing 100 is provided with two movable cavities 110 corresponding to the two movable portions 220 one by one, the movable portions 220 are movably inserted into the corresponding movable cavities 110, and the telescopic structure of the electronic product fixing device comprises two elastic elements 300 corresponding to the two movable cavities 110 one by one; the elastic element 300 is located in the corresponding movable cavity 110 and abuts against the cavity wall of the corresponding movable cavity 110 and the bearing end 221 of the movable portion 220. By adopting the above structure, the stability of the movement of the movable base 200 can be improved.
The first protection housing 100 includes a base 121 and a protection cover 122 fixedly connected to the base 121, and the movable cavity 110 is surrounded by the base 121 and the protection cover 122, so that the movable cavity 110 is convenient to be manufactured. Of course, in addition to this, the structure of the first protection housing 100 is not limited to this, and other structures, such as a housing that can be integrally formed, or an assembly formed by combining a plurality of accessories, can be adopted, but the first protection housing 100 includes a base 121 and a protection outer cover 122 fixed on the base 121, and the movable cavity 110 is surrounded by the base 121 and the protection outer cover 122.
The base 121 is further provided with a surrounding wall protruding towards the protective cover 122, and the protective cover 122 and the surrounding wall of the base 121 enclose the movable cavity 110. The base 121 is fixedly connected with the protective outer cover 122 through screws, so that the base 121 and the protective outer cover 122 can be conveniently assembled and disassembled. Specifically, the base 121 is provided with a through hole, the protecting cover 122 is provided with a threaded hole, and the screw is inserted into the through hole of the base 121 and is in threaded connection with the threaded hole of the protecting cover 122. Of course, in addition to the above, the protective cover 122 may be fixedly connected to the base 121 by a buckle or a bayonet lock, but the base 121 is fixedly connected to the protective cover 122 by a screw, which is a preferred embodiment of the present utility model, and the base 121 and the protective cover 122 can be easily assembled and disassembled.
The movable portion 220 is a bolt screwed on the second protection housing 210, so as to facilitate the disassembly and assembly between the movable portion 220 and the second protection housing 210. Specifically, the end portion of the bolt is formed as the bearing end 221, an opening through which the screw of the bolt passes is formed at one end of the movable cavity 110 near the second protection housing 210, and the diameter of the end portion of the bolt is larger than that of the opening, so that the end portion of the bolt can play a limiting role to prevent the movable portion 220 from being separated from the first protection housing 100.
Wherein the elastic element 300 is a spring. Of course, in addition to the above, the elastic element 300 may also be a spring plate, an elastic sleeve, or the like, but the elastic element 300 is a spring, which is the most preferred embodiment of the present utility model, and can provide elastic force, reduce cost, and facilitate installation.
The first protection casing 100 and the second protection casing 210 may be matched with the electronic product by fastening, sleeving, etc., so long as they can be matched with the electronic product. As a preferred embodiment of the present utility model, the first protection casing 100 and the second protection casing 210 are both used for fastening and matching with the electronic product, so as to improve the convenience and stability of matching.
The electronic product can be a mobile phone or a tablet personal computer and the like.
